For my fellow Vietnamese brides out there!
What kind of ao dai are you wearing to your wedding? Will it be red or yellow, or another color?
And will you be wearing an outer coat over it or the ao dai by itself?
And will you have a long tail that looks like a train, a trend I have been seeing in some weddings?
I'm thinking of ordering my ao dai from aodaivinh.com and I am looking for advice first on which one to order.

i just recently received my ao dai from ao dai vinh and the fittin gis good except for the arm area but thats fixable.. i already had several custom made ao dai of my own so when my sister went back i sent with her the picture of the exact ao dai i wanted from there catalog as well as one of my own ao dai as my size for them to use as measurements. and it turned out just perfect.. the one i chose is a pink fushia with the jacket as well.. simple but still nice.
